A Chemical peel NYC is a procedure in which the skin essentially is allowed to grow back after its top layer has been removed. The new skin that grows in its place is said to be smoother, healthier and younger-looking.
WHY IS A CHEMICAL PEEL DONE?
The motive of a chemical peel is to get a back a healthier skin once again. The reasons for skin damage may be many. For example:
· Pigmentation due to sun damage
· Wrinkles due to the natural process of aging
· Skin discolorations
· Scars due to a medical procedure or even due to Acne.
TYPES OF CHEMICAL PEELS
Chemical peels can vary in depth. Different conditions require different kinds of treatment. According to this, a professional will guide you as to which depth you should go to get the best results.
Three depths of a chemical peel are being used:
1. LIGHT CHEMICAL PEEL: Here, only the superficial layer of the skin that is the epidermis is removed. This is done if you have fine wrinkles, dryness, mild acne, etc. The frequency of this peel can be as early as two to five weeks depending upon the requirement.
2. MEDIUM CHEMICAL PEEL: In this method, the top layer of the skin (Epidermis), as well as the upper part of the middle layer (Dermis), is removed. This can be used to correct uneven skin tone, acne of a little higher severity, and deeper lines and wrinkles.
3. DEEP CHEMICAL PEEL: This method involves the removal of a significantly thick layer of the topmost skin. The cells from the epidermis as well as the parts of the middle and lower layers of the dermis are removed with suitable chemicals. Usually, deep chemical peels are done in cases with severe acne scarring or other kinds of scars.
WHAT TO EXPECT?
· Before the procedure is done, any skin conditions that you might have the need to be discussed. After the initial check has been done, the skin is cleansed. This will make it ready for the facial peel NYC.
· Thereafter, a cotton ball or gauze is used to apply the chemical solution being used. This maybe Glycolic acid, salicylic acid, trichloroacetic acid or carbolic acid depending upon the depth of the peel.
· The treated skin will show some whitening. You might even feel a slight stinging sensation on your face.
· In medium and deep peels, topical or regional anesthesia may be used. This is because these peels go deeper into the skin and may excite the nerve ending around these skin cells.
· The chemical is kept on the skin for a few minutes depending on the requirement. It is then countered with a neutralizing solution. In mild cases, a neutralizing solution might not be needed. The face is just washed copiously with water.
After the procedure is over, your skin may show redness and feel dry and mildly irritated in case it is sensitive. The professional might apply oil or petroleum jelly to get rid of the dryness.
